Dr. Golt Herstege of University of Groningen studied the brains of men and women during orgasm by having them lay flat with their heads in an MRI scanner while their partner brought them to climax. However, because of the oxygen tracing equipment, they only had two minutes to do it.  Basically, this guy expected couples to get each other off while laying on a table in a laboratory with the pressure of a 2 minute timer running.

But they did it. For science.

THAT MAGICAL TOUCH

tumblr_lmwtnzOH3i1qaexoao1_500.gif

Your genitals are full of nerve endings just waiting to be played with. When that happens, they signal your limbic system that it’s time to bust out the dopamine. The same exact thing happens when you’re about to get a rush of cocaine or eat a delectable piece of cheesecake. Basically, dopamine makes you happy and everything suddenly feels amazing. Your brain is also happy, because it’s getting more nutritiously oxygenated blood.

CLIMAX TIME

rsvpmagazine.ie_.gif

Now that your blood is flowing, your pupils are dilated, you’re breathing heavily, and the dopamine has increased every ounce of stimulation you’re receiving, the height of pleasure reaches its peak and your hypothalamus gives you the grand finale.

THE FINAL RELEASE

anigif_optimized-16911-1420669708-15.gif

You finish with a flood of extra dopamine and serotonin (another happy hormone). Also, orgasm stops the spinal cord from releasing pain transmitters, which is why things like biting and hair pulling don’t hurt as much, and can even feel good.
